need to know how to look for a real abody 4 speed car

Z-bar bracket on the frame

View attachment 1715025798

Only problem is that there are a few cases of these having been on cars that were automatics from the factory. Not many, but just because it's there doesn't mean 100% it's a factory 4 speed car. Fender tag and for '72 the VIN should be on the transmission pad, those would be a lot more solid. Pedals can be swapped, floor humps can be welded in. And unless you can look under the carpet or do a good inspection under the car it could be pretty hard to tell if the floor hump is factory or not.

And honestly, if I was going to pay the kind of price an original 340-4 speed Demon would bring, I'd walk away if the guy wouldn't let me look under the car to check the VIN's. Or at least had good pictures that were clearly of the car involved.
